Common Signs You May Need Collision Repair
After a collision, even minor damage can hide serious issues. Signs you need repair include:
- Visible dents, scratches, or crumpled panels
- Doors or trunk not closing properly
- Unusual noises or vibrations while driving
- Misaligned headlights or taillights
- Paint chipping or peeling around impact area

How Collision Repair Is Typically Handled Locally
Local specialists typically begin with damage assessment, structural inspection, and restoration of body panels and frame to pre-accident condition. Based on Hamilton's driving conditions, technicians also focus on:
Undercarriage rust-through and corrosion of structural components affecting collision repair structural integrity; pre-existing salt damage may compromise weld strength
Paint and protective coating condition assessment before collision repair repainting to ensure adhesion and durability in salt-spray environment
Electrical system and sensor damage assessment particularly for modern vehicles with ADAS systems affected by salt spray and thermal cycling damage

Salt corrodes structural welds and bolts, potentially compromising pre-existing repairs. During collision repair involving welding on corroded structures, weld quality may be compromised. Request structural inspection and corrosion testing before welding. Additionally, salt damage may require replacement of corroded structural components rather than simple realignment, increasing repair costs by 20-40% compared to non-salty environments.

Salt spray damages front-facing cameras, radar sensors, and ultrasonic sensors on modern safety systems. After collision repair, ADAS sensors often require recalibration or replacement. Hamilton's humidity and salt environment also affect sensor lens clarity and electronic connections. Ensure collision repair shops include sensor inspection and proper ADAS calibration (on the correct road surface) in the repair estimate, as this adds $300-800 to repairs but is essential for safety system function.
